Frequently Asked Questions

What are some notable waterfalls to visit in the Val-d'Illiez region?

Beyond the most popular spots, the Val-d'Illiez region offers several unique waterfalls. The Vogealle Waterfall is nestled in a rugged Alpine landscape near Sixt-Fer-à-Cheval, part of a protected nature reserve. Another impressive sight is the Pissevache Waterfall, also known as Cascade de Salanfe, which plunges 116 meters into the Rhône valley near Vernayaz.

Are there any family-friendly waterfalls in Val-d'Illiez?

Yes, the Pissevache Waterfall is specifically noted as family-friendly. Its impressive height and accessibility make it a great option for visitors of all ages. The Cascade de Frassenaye is also described as perfect for a family outing with picnic areas, though check for current trail conditions as it has temporary closures.

What kind of natural features can I expect to see around the waterfalls?

The waterfalls around Val-d'Illiez are set within diverse natural landscapes. You can expect rugged Alpine terrain, lush forests, and views of prominent peaks like the Dents Blanches and Dents du Midi. Many waterfalls, like the Vogealle Waterfall, are located within protected nature reserves, offering opportunities to observe rich biodiversity.

What is the best time of year to visit the waterfalls in Val-d'Illiez?

The waterfalls are generally beautiful throughout the year, with different seasonal appeals. The "Bayard" waterfall, for example, flows continuously, fed by snows in winter and rains in autumn. Summer offers pleasant conditions for hiking and enjoying picnic areas, while winter can transform the landscape into a snow-covered wonderland, as seen around Cascade d'Arveyron.

Are there any waterfalls that are particularly challenging to reach?

The Bout du Monde Waterfalls, located within the Sixt-Passy Nature Reserve, are described as challenging to reach, requiring sturdy walking shoes due to the terrain. The ascent at the end of the valley to Bout du Monde can be steep and lacks shade.

Can I find waterfalls that flow consistently throughout the year?

Yes, the "Bayard" waterfall, situated at 1,130 meters above sea level, is known for flowing continuously throughout the year. It is fed by snowmelt in winter and heavy rains in autumn, ensuring a consistent flow.

What do visitors say about the waterfalls in the Val-d'Illiez region?

Visitors often describe the waterfalls as magical and impressive. For instance, the Bout du Monde Waterfalls are praised as a 'magical area to walk.' The Pissevache Waterfall is considered one of the most beautiful sights in the country, and the Vogealle Waterfall offers a stunning view, even if slightly off the main path.

Is there a waterfall that offers a good spot for a relaxing break or picnic?

The Cascade des Brochaux, located in Montriond within the larger Portes du Soleil area, is an ideal spot for a relaxing break or a picnic in nature. Its natural pool and surrounding woods provide a tranquil setting.

Are there any temporary closures or important notices for waterfall trails?

Yes, it's important to check for current conditions. For example, the trail to Cascade de Frassenaye was temporarily closed due to a landslide from October 22, 2025, to April 30, 2026. An alternative path to Soi is available via the Pro Déforan path during this period.

Which waterfall offers views of the Dents Blanches and Dents du Midi mountains?

The Cascade de Frassenaye is known for its magical setting and offers direct views of the Dents Blanches and Dents du Midi mountains. It is highly visible from the side opposite the Dents du Midi.
